Become the Best Manager in My Lil Afterlife
After two years in development, indie developer JSquared Games has confirmed that its cozy supernatural life sim My Lil Afterlife will launch on Steam for Windows and Linux on July 28. Blending wholesome management gameplay with light action and spooky charm, the game invites players to build and customize their own version of the afterlife.

In My Lil Afterlife, players step into the role of a little litch. They will be responsible for creating a welcoming home for a growing community of ghostly residents. As new spirits arrive, each with their own unique personalities, players can expand and decorate their realm using furniture, crafted items, and collectibles found throughout the world.
Customization also extends to your character, allowing you to unlock and wear a variety of outfits and accessories sold by the residents you recruit. At launch, the game will feature 10 different spooky companions. This ranges from a wise skeleton to a cheeky sasquatch, with more characters planned in future updates.
Beyond its cozy atmosphere, My Lil Afterlife also includes an action-focused side. Players can explore the mysterious Reaper’s Tower, where the once-benevolent Grim Reaper has fallen into madness. Using magical spells, they’ll battle enemies, uncover secrets, and collect valuable crafting materials and decorative rewards.
